A law firm is seeking a Mid-Level IP Litigation (Life Sciences) Associate Attorney for their Palo Alto office. This role requires a dedicated individual with a strong background in intellectual property matters, particularly in patent and/or trade secret litigation within the life sciences industry.

 

Job Overview:

The Mid-Level IP Litigation (Life Sciences) Associate Attorney will be responsible for handling a diverse range of intellectual property litigation matters, with a focus on cases within the life sciences sector. This role involves providing legal counsel and representation to clients, conducting legal research, drafting pleadings and motions, and participating in all aspects of the litigation process.

 

Duties:

  • Representing clients in intellectual property litigation matters, including patent and/or trade secret disputes within the life sciences industry.
  • Conducting legal research and analysis to support case strategies and arguments.
  • Drafting pleadings, motions, briefs, and other legal documents.
  • Participating in all stages of the litigation process, including discovery, depositions, hearings, and trials.
  • Collaborating with other attorneys, experts, and clients to develop and execute case strategies.
  • Providing legal counsel and advice to clients on ongoing intellectual property matters and potential litigation risks.
  • Managing client relationships and communication throughout the litigation process.

 

Requirements:

  • Admission to a State Bar is required.
  • Strong academic credentials in law and undergraduate coursework.
  • Undergraduate degree in Biology, Chemistry, Materials Science, Genetics, or Biochemistry is preferred.
  • 3-5 years of experience with intellectual property matters, including patent and/or trade secret litigation.
  • Excellent leadership skills and a strong work ethic.
  • Outstanding research and analytical skills.
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ills.
  • Sound legal and business knowledge in working on a broad spectrum of cases and counseling clients with respect to ongoing matters.

This vigorous, multi-national juggernaut splits its business into several practice areas, including corporate finance, labor and employment, environmental, technology licensing, litigation, patent and intellectual property, tax, and real estate. The firm boasts particularly strong intellectual property and intellectual property litigation practices. The firm?s clients include private and public companies in a number of diverse fields, such as computer hardware and software, telecommunications, biotechnology, investment banking, and transportation. Despite its size and impressive stature within the legal community, insiders claim the firm maintains a ?small firm? culture ? associates are neither competitive nor pretentious and the firm itself is notoriously not hierarchical. Although the firm will never initiate salary hikes, compensation is competitive, and billable hour pressure is manageable.
